Pumpkin Cheese Tart requires about 1 hour and 20 minutes from start to finish. One portion of this dish contains about 5g of protein, 11g of fat, and a total of 263 calories. This recipe covers 8% of your daily requirements of vitamins and minerals. This recipe serves 10.
